Report: West Ham accept Diame bid
© PA Photos
An unnamed Premier League club reportedly triggers the release clause in the contract of West Ham United midfielder Mohamed Diame, who has been linked with interest from Spurs and Arsenal in recent weeks.

A Premier League club has reportedly triggered the release clause in Mohamed Diame's West Ham United contract.

The Senegalese midfielder, 25, who joined the Hammers on a three-year deal in June, is free to leave Upton Park for £3.5m.

Diame has been strongly linked with interest from Tottenham Hotspur and Arsenal in recent weeks and, according to Sky Sports News, an unnamed top-flight side has had an offer for the player accepted this evening.

Diame has made 20 first-team appearances for West Ham, scoring two goals.
